MRG World gets permission to start construction work at all its Gurugram projects
Gurugram: Government of Haryana has granted permission to MRG World to resume construction operations at its three projects located in Gurugram — Ultimus (Sector 90), The Meridian (Sector 89), The Balcony (Sector 93). According to the group, the work at the sites will resume from May 2, 2020. According to a press release issued by the company, the permission by the authorities is to operate establishment in a single shift during the lockdown period. The numbers of labours working are 195, 150, 150 at The Balcony, Ultimus, and The Meridian respectively. The number of vehicles allowed is different for different projects.
Rajat Goel, Joint MD, MRG World, said, “We are grateful to the Government of Haryana for allowing us the work on construction sites. In fact, we were ahead of the delivery timelines as we started work early on our projects. With this lifting of restrictions, we will now try to achieve better speed and give projects much before the deadline given to the customers.”
